Can’t Fly? Go Caravan

With travel plans constantly changing, the jet fuel crisis adding pressure to airfares, and uncertainty surrounding air travel, many holidaymakers are rethinking how they explore the UK and beyond. While airport queues, cancellations, and rising costs make flying feel increasingly stressful, there’s a simpler, more flexible alternative waiting right on your driveway.

If you can’t fly — you can caravan.

At Grantham’s, we’ve seen a growing number of families, couples, and retirees rediscover the joy of caravanning. And it’s easy to see why.

Freedom Without the Fuss

Flying often means fixed schedules, luggage limits, and unexpected disruptions. Caravanning gives you control. Leave when you want. Pack what you need. Change your plans if the weather turns or you fancy somewhere new.

Whether it’s the dramatic coastline of Cornwall, the rolling countryside of The Lake District, or the rugged beauty of the Scottish Highlands, your holiday starts the moment you hitch up and head out.

No check-in desks. No baggage carousels. No delays at 30,000 feet.

Your Own Space, Your Own Comfort

One of the biggest advantages of caravanning is having your own familiar space wherever you go. Your bed. Your kitchen. Your essentials. For many travellers, especially families, that comfort makes all the difference.

You’re not relying on hotel availability or fluctuating prices. Your accommodation travels with you.

Cost-Effective Travel

With rising airfare and hidden airline fees, a short flight can quickly become expensive. Caravanning offers excellent value, particularly for longer stays or multiple trips throughout the year.

Once you own a caravan, your holidays become far more affordable — and far more frequent.

Discover More of the UK

Some of the most beautiful destinations are right here at home. From coastal retreats to peaceful countryside escapes, the UK is filled with hidden gems that are best enjoyed at your own pace.

Caravanning encourages slower, more meaningful travel. You’re not rushing to catch a transfer — you’re stopping at farm shops, scenic lay-bys, and charming villages along the way.

Travel With Confidence

In uncertain times, flexibility matters. Caravanning allows you to adapt quickly without the risk of last-minute cancellations or international travel complications.

If plans change, your caravan doesn’t.
